I have a system that my associate Danilo uses for one of his clients. I wouldn’t call it a SaaS product yet; it’s a system I built for him and his client is using it right now. It has the potential to grow and attract more users, so it could become a SaaS in the future. That may take time, but that’s fine, I’ve already been paid for creating the system.

API Development

While working on the system, I learned that Danilo needed cloud code integrated with it. For the first time I built a version that can be accessed via an API, just as a human would use the front end. The initial release is a read‑only API for AI agents to access. Danilo asked for more functionality, so I’m planning to make the system truly API‑first. The front end and back end were originally built without AI in mind, but I’ll expand the API functions so cloud code can operate, and any AI can use them.

Future Outlook

I think this project will teach me a lot because I believe more systems will be used by AI agents rather than directly by humans. AI agents that people subscribe to will delegate tasks to these systems, so we’ll see more software designed for AI interaction instead of being built from scratch for human users.
